Transaction 5d7d86b8b1c95b461392b1365fd15eb258935670b241cae63e828da3ca2d54f1
1 Input
1 Output
-
5d7d86b8b1c95b461392b1365fd15eb258935670b241cae63e828da3ca2d54f1:0
- value
- 20845259
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 684efc51a6c713faee8c98e6531e30a62f4a71cf OP_EQUAL
- address
- 3BCYpWcAQcZg5Ejprf1iuD7khXymU6qPrC